The RedCat 51 has been one of the most recommended first “real” telescopes in astrophotography forums for several years running, and it’s still a common answer in 2026. It’s a compact 51 mm apochromatic refractor at 250 mm focal length and f/4.9 — a fast, wide-field instrument built specifically for imaging rather than visual use.

What it’s good at
A fast f/4.9 focal ratio means shorter exposure times for the same signal versus a slower scope, which matters a lot when you’re stacking dozens of subs in a single night. At 250 mm it’s a wide-field instrument, well suited to large targets like the Rosette Nebula, the Pleiades, or comets with long tails, rather than small targets like planetary nebulae. Its built-in field flattener (part of the petzval design) means no separate flattener purchase or spacing to calibrate, which removes a common source of setup error for a first APO refractor.
Where it falls short
250 mm is short enough that galaxies and smaller nebulae will appear quite small in the frame — you’re trading resolution on small targets for a wide, forgiving field. It also needs a mount capable of guiding accurately at this focal length and a camera to go with it; the $1,098 price is for the optical tube alone, not a complete rig. Buyers sometimes underestimate the total cost once a mount, camera, guide scope and software are added.
Who should buy it
Imagers moving up from a camera-lens-only setup who want their first true telescope, especially if wide nebulae and star clusters are the priority over galaxies or planets.
